According to the Mauna Kea Visitor information center: 2-wheel drive vehicles are not permitted above the Visitor Information Station. A 4-wheel drive vehicle with Low Range is STRONGLY RECOMMENDED. About 300 yards beyond the station, the pavement ends and the next 4 and a half miles are a steep graded-gravel road. nascar clash qualifying speeds
